Support The Orland Township Food Pantry With ‘Pack-A-Backpack’

Orland Township Food Pantry seeking “Back Pack” donations for ‘Pack-A-Backpack’ program to provide low-income Orland Township resident children with much needed school supplies.

When you’re struggling to feed your family or afford a roof over their heads, school supplies don’t always make the list. That’s why the Orland Township Food Pantry is asking the community to come together and ‘Pack-A-Backpack!

Items like backpacks, art supplies, and writing tools are essential to prepare children mentally, emotionally, and physically for school.

New backpacks and new supplies give children a sense of security and excitement as they begin the school year. With this assistance, parents can focus on rent and groceries instead of facing the stress of school-related expenses.

In addition to the program, Orland Township will also host a Back-to-School Health Fair on Aug. 20.

The event is open to all Orland Township residents as they partner with local schools, community organizations, and local medical centers to distribute care and compassion to students in need.

 

Pack-A-Backpack donations can provide low-income Orland Township resident children ranging from Kindergarten to High School with pencils, notebooks, backpacks and other supplies – giving all our local learners the same opportunity to achieve their potential.

A full list of suggested supplies for each grade level can be found at orlandtownship.org/btshf, along with a sign-up link to commit to donating.
